Как написать правильный URL для изображения - PullRequest
0 голосов
/ 27 октября 2019

Я создаю игру с JavaFX и хочу загрузить в нее изображения. У меня проблемы с поиском правильного URL для загрузки изображения

Предполагается, что это игра памяти, а изображение должно быть загружено в кнопку для взаимодействия с игроком. Обычно, когда я пытался работать с изображениями, я запускаю URL в папке проектов, и он работает нормально, но здесь я получаю сообщения об ошибках. Я могу заставить его работать, только когда набираю полный URL-адрес с диска C :, но нельзя ли получить к нему доступ только из папки проектов?

Это конструктор класса для карт памяти

public MemoryCard(String front, int picID) 
    {
        front = new ImageView(front);

        picBack = new ImageView("src/grafics/back.jpg");
        setGraphic(picBack);

        //...
    }

Я создал папку с именем grafics в исходной папке с правильными изображениями внутри. Я думал, что это будет работать, но это просто дает мне сообщение IllegalArgumentException в строке, где я загружаю изображение.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...